Brand Marketing Intern

Vision Statement: Innovating the solutions that power the world’s best entertaining and food service experiences.

Mission Statement: Perlick is a 5th generation family business that serves as an essential partner in the commercial foodservice and residential appliance industries. We put our customers first in everything we do by engaging a team of world class associates to develop, produce, and deliver premium products and customer experiences that provide a lifetime of exceptional value.

Perlick Values: Lead By Serving – others before self, Grow by Innovation – solutions that exceed our customers’ expectations, Continuous Improvement – strive to get better every day, Live the Legacy – maintain our positive reputations with the future in mind

 

 

SUMMARY:

Perlick is seeking a highly motivated Brand Marketing Intern to support our brand marketing initiatives. This internship offers a unique opportunity to work closely with multiple teams, including Brand Marketing, Product Management, Marketing Communications, Sales, and IT, to ensure the successful execution of product solutions and marketing programs that meet the needs of both internal and external customers.

In this role, you will gain hands-on experience working with cross-functional teams to develop and refine marketing assets that elevate our products and strengthen the Perlick brand. The ideal candidate will be a creative and proactive individual who is eager to learn about the intersection of brand strategy, marketing communications, and product marketing.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ES & REPONSIBILITIES :

  1. Collaborate with cross-functional teams (including marketing, product management, sales, and IT) to create visually compelling product marketing assets that align with our brand identity and engage target audiences.
  2. Assist in the design and development of commercial marketing resources, such as presentations, digital content, and promotional materials, ensuring they are visually on-brand and impactful across all platforms.
  3. Maintain brand consistency across various marketing channels by ensuring that all visual and written assets align with our established brand guidelines.
  4. Conduct market research to support the design of engaging product positioning, competitive analysis, and customer insights, helping to inform creative decisions and marketing strategies.
  5. Contribute to the creation and execution of brand campaigns, including designing assets for social media, email marketing, and advertising to drive engagement and brand awareness.
  6. Track and analyze key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the success of design-driven marketing initiatives, ensuring the visual content performs effectively and delivers results.
  7. Support the development of marketing collateral to ensure high-quality, visually compelling assets that help elevate our brand presence and ensure that our products are represented by the best possible design.
  8. Assist in event planning and execution for various marketing activities and activations nationwide, ensuring that these events align with Perlick’s brand image and create meaningful experiences for attendees. This includes supporting the design and coordination of materials and logistics for events, trade shows, and promotional activations.
  9. Support the development of an influencer program, helping identify and collaborate with relevant influencers to amplify our brand presence and engage new audiences across social media and other digital platforms.
  10. Assist in new product launches, including updating pricing, spec sheets, AutoQuotes, and website PIM systems to ensure accurate and up-to-date information is available across sales and marketing channels.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ure a smooth product launch process and seamless integration of new product details into Perlick’s internal systems, customer-facing materials, and website.
  11. Other duties, projects, and learning objectives as assigned.
